ST. PETERSBURG, Florida – In a St. Petersburg murder investigation, a third adolescent was taken into custody, a Monday announcement stated.

Three youths, two of whom were 16 years old and one of whom was 17 years old, reportedly approached 21-year-old Marcus Rivers as he was seated in a car at the junction of 80th Avenue Northeast and Riverside Drive Northeast, according to St. Petersburg police.

The statement claims that “shots were fired,” killing Rivers and seriously injuring the 17-year-old.

The three adolescents were accused of armed robbery with a deadly weapon and first-degree murder.

The 17-year-old was additionally accused of being a delinquent who possessed a handgun.

All of the people engaged in the shooting, according to the investigators, knew one another. Drug use was cited as a contributing factor in the murder.
